Benefits and Durability of Precast Concrete Projects

Precast concrete has numerous advantages in construction projects, both above and below ground.
It is used in large government infrastructure projects. Developers use it to construct large-scale homes and to wind sidewalks through newly laid streets. Parks and recreation budgets include it because it is cheap, readily available, and makes an ideal stormwater removal system.

Production that is sustainable

Columbia Precast Products are engineered, designed, and manufactured with consideration for the environment, the economy, and our community. If at all possible, we source locally. This allows us to contribute to the growth of our region while remaining committed to environmentally friendly production practices. These include the use of natural materials such as stone and sand, recycled steel, and repurposed bi-products such as power plant fly ash.
